"""The core, a collection of Calendar and Scheduling objects. This is an example of parsing an ics file as a stream of calendar objects: ```python from pathlib import Path from ical.calendar_stream import IcsCalendarStream filename = Path("example/calendar.ics") with filename.open() as ics_file: stream = IcsCalendarStream.from_ics(ics_file.read()) print("File contains %s calendar(s)", len(stream.calendars)) ``` You can encode a calendar stream as ics content calling the `ics()` method on the `IcsCalendarStream`: ```python from pathlib import Path filename = Path("/tmp/output.ics") with filename.open(mode="w") as ics_file: ics_file.write(stream.ics()) ``` """ # mypy: allow-any-generics from __future__ import annotations import logging from pydantic import Field, field_serializer from .calendar import Calendar from .component import ComponentModel from .parsing.component import encode_content, parse_content from .types.data_types import serialize_field from .exceptions import CalendarParseError from pydantic import ConfigDict _LOGGER = logging.getLogger(__name__) class CalendarStream(ComponentModel): """A container that is a collection of calendaring information. This object supports parsing an rfc5545 calendar file, but does not support encoding. See `IcsCalendarStream` instead for encoding ics files. """ calendars: list[Calendar] = Field(alias="vcalendar", default_factory=list) @classmethod def from_ics(cls, content: str) -> "CalendarStream": """Factory method to create a new instance from an rfc5545 iCalendar content.""" components = parse_content(content) result: dict[str, list] = {"vcalendar": []} for component in components: result.setdefault(component.name, []) result[component.name].append(component.as_dict()) _LOGGER.debug("Parsing object %s", result) return cls(**result) def ics(self) -> str: """Encode the calendar stream as an rfc5545 iCalendar Stream content.""" return encode_content(self.__encode_component_root__().components) class IcsCalendarStream(CalendarStream): """A calendar stream that supports parsing and encoding ICS.""" @classmethod def calendar_from_ics(cls, content: str) -> Calendar: """Load a single calendar from an ics string.""" stream = cls.from_ics(content) if len(stream.calendars) == 1: return stream.calendars[0] if len(stream.calendars) == 0: return Calendar() raise CalendarParseError("Calendar Stream had more than one calendar") @classmethod def calendar_to_ics(cls, calendar: Calendar) -> str: """Serialize a calendar as an ICS stream.""" stream = cls(vcalendar=[calendar]) return stream.ics() model_config = ConfigDict( validate_assignment=True, populate_by_name=True, ) serialize_fields = field_serializer("*")(serialize_field) # type: ignore[pydantic-field]
